                See the trouble with Usyk is he is very crafty and shifty. He sees the punches coming before they land and then roll with them; Especially if he is fighting off the back foot.

                The reason why he was being tagged earlier by Bellew was because Oleksandr was fighting off his front foot, where Bellew was countering and catching him coming in.

                He won't have to implement that strategy against Wilder since he'll be fighting off the back foot. However it's still tricky though cause Wilder doesn't have to land all that flush of a punch just in order to hurt or drop you.
